Average Cost of Home Insurance in 2022: All You Need to Know
Annual cost of home insurance in the US and $1,383 in 2022 for a $250,000 household, according to Bankrate. FActors such as your location, region, the type and amount of content you choose, your credit score and more can affect this amount.

How Much Does Home Insurance Cost? in Different countries
Here is an estimate of the annual fees you may have to pay depending on the country you live in:
Government | Average home insurance premiums (per year) |
Alabama | $1,597 |
Alaska | $1,001 |
Arizona | $1,216 |
Arkansas | $2,104 |
California | $1,000 |
Colorado | $1,690 |
Connecticut | $1,284 |
Delaware | $770 |
Florida | $1,358 |
Georgia | $1,400 |
Hawaii | $400 |
Idaho | $890 |
Illinois | $1,422 |
Indiana | $1,100 |
Iowa | $1,390 |
Kansas | $2,767 |
Kentucky | $1,850 |
Louisiana | $1,813 |
Maine | $956 |
Maryland | $1,130 |
Massachusetts | $1,307 |
Michigan | $1,120 |
Minnesota | $1,785 |
Mississippi | $1,773 |
Missouri | $1,572 |
Montana | $1,878 |
Nebraska | $2,900 |
Nevada | $822 |
New Hampshire | $794 |
New Jersey | $751 |
New Mexico | $2,024 |
new York | $987 |
North Carolina | $1,297 |
North Dakota | $1,941 |
Ohio | $1,116 |
Oklahoma | $3,518 |
Oregon | $712 |
Pennsylvania | $736 |
Rhode Island | $1,193 |
South Carolina | $1,142 |
South Dakota | $1,997 |
Tennessee | $1,695 |
Texas | $1,883 |
Utah | $646 |
Vermont | $686 |
Virginia | $1,017 |
Washington | $900 |
Washington, DC | $909 |
West Virginia | $1,127 |
Wisconsin | $990 |
Wyoming | $805 |
Source: Bankrate

When calculating the cost of home insurance, insurers take many factors into consideration. Some of these things are:
Substitute Price
The more your home costs to update, the more you will pay. This is because the conversion rate is based on many variables. It varies depending on the square footage and local building budget as well as its unique features and architecture.
However, you can get a rough estimate with basic calculations. Contacting an insurance agent or insurance agent will help you!
Home Insurance Loan
Insurers use interest rates as a way to determine the likelihood of paying on time. Credit is often used to measure risk which helps determine the amount of home insurance. Poor credit can make insurers see you as someone who is more likely to file a claim than those with better credit.
Your credit score can have a significant impact on premium rates and therefore change the cost of your home insurance. Good credit can be seen as a low risk that can help you reduce costs.

Population
Demographics, such as age, marital status, and gender make a big difference in determining the cost of home insurance.
According to Bankrateinsurance companies pay lower rates to married couples because they think they are in the lower risk category.
There are many insurance companies that like to take advantage of their large customers. According to Quote WizardIf you’re over 55, you may be eligible for the senior discount when purchasing home insurance.
Deductibles
Homeowner’s insurance is the amount the homeowner will pay out of pocket before receiving compensation for repairs to their property. It also determines how much you will save on your monthly payments.
If you make your deductible higher, it can lower your monthly payments. However, if there is a claim for an accident that is very expensive then it can cost more than what is saved in premiums.
